Kyoto and Nara
Your guided tour takes you through several important sites around Kyoto and Nara. Start at Fushimi Inari Shrine to walk through those famous red torii gates. From there, head to Nara Park where sacred deer roam freely. Todaiji Temple houses a historic Great Buddha you'll see up close, and Kasuga Taisha shrine rounds out the day. Your English-speaking guide handles all the navigation and details.

Kyoto
You'll have another free day, this time to explore Kyoto at your own pace. The Arashiyama district is worth your time, especially Tenryuji Temple and the Sagano Bamboo Forest. Togetsukyo Bridge offers nice views, and the Okochi-Sanso villa provides insight into traditional architecture. Use taxis or the local public transportation system to move between spots.

Hakone and Bullet Train to Kyoto
Your Hakone day tour starts with a scenic cruise on Lake Ashino aboard the Hakone Pirate Ship. Next, take the Hakone Ropeway up to Owakudani for volcanic crater views and geothermal activity. Later, visit the Mishima Skywalk suspension bridge where you can see Mt. Fuji and Suruga Bay on clear days. By evening, you'll board the Shinkansen bullet train to Kyoto with your ticket included, and the route offers scenic stops along the way.

Mount Fuji Region
This day focuses on Mt. Fuji viewing and the surrounding area. You'll start at Arakurayama Sengen Park, a well-known spot for seeing Mt. Fuji with seasonal beauty, especially cherry blossoms if you're traveling in spring. An optional scenic lake cruise on Lake Kawaguchi gives you another perspective. After that, explore Oshino Hakkai, an area with eight historic springs that date back over 1200 years, surrounded by some beautiful village scenery.
